Docs.rs
llm-weaver-0.1.95
llm-weaver 0.1.95
Permalink
Docs.rs crate page
MIT
Links
Repository
crates.io
Source
Owners
snowmead
Dependencies
aquamarine ^0.3.2
normal
async-openai ^0.21.0
normal
async-trait ^0.1.73
normal
bounded-integer ^0.5.7
normal
chrono ^0.4.31
normal
num-traits ^0.2.17
normal
redis ^0.25.0
normal
serde ^1.0.188
normal
serde_json ^1.0.107
normal
thiserror ^1.0.49
normal
tiktoken-rs ^0.5.8
normal
tokio ^1.32.0
normal
tracing ^0.1.37
normal
Versions
58.97%
of the crate is documented
Platform
i686-unknown-linux-gnu
x86_64-unknown-linux-gnu
Feature flags
Rust
About docs.rs
Privacy policy
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
llm_weaver
0.1.95
Module types
Enums
Constants
Type Aliases
In crate llm_weaver
Module
llm_weaver
::
types
Copy item path
source
·
[
−
]
Enums
§
LoomError
StorageError
WeaveError
WrapperRole
Wrapped
Role
for custom implementations.
Constants
§
ASSISTANT_ROLE
FUNCTION_ROLE
SYSTEM_ROLE
USER_ROLE
Type Aliases
§
F32
Base type for all configuration parameters.
PromptModelRequest
PromptModelTokens
SummaryModelTokens